What Type Of Electrical Connection Does A Hot Tub Require?

Adding a hot tub in your area, means making smart choices about the power it needs to run safely and efficiently. Electrical requirements affect how fast water heats, whether pumps can run at the same time as the heater, and how reliably protection devices trip. Codes also define where disconnects must be located and how equipment is bonded to reduce shock risk. Understanding the connection type up front prevents nuisance tripping, slow heat times, and failed inspections.


The two common connections and what they mean

Most hot tubs use either a 120-volt “plug-and-play” setup or a 240-volt hard-wired connection. A 120-volt unit typically runs on a dedicated 15–20 amp GFCI-protected receptacle and often cannot heat while high-speed jets run. A 240-volt spa is usually hard-wired on a dedicated 40–60 amp circuit with a GFCI spa panel and an outdoor, weather-rated disconnect within sight. Because 240-volt heaters have much higher wattage—often three to four times that of 120-volt models—they recover heat faster and support multiple pumps. Ground-fault circuit interrupters are engineered to trip around 4–6 milliamps of leakage in a fraction of a second, a critical safeguard in wet locations.

For 240-volt models, many manufacturers call for a four-wire feed (two hots, neutral, and equipment ground), though some designs are three-wire with no neutral—always follow the spa nameplate. Article 680 of widely recognized electrical standards addresses GFCI protection, equipment grounding, and equipotential bonding (commonly using #8 AWG copper) to minimize voltage differences near the water. Expect outdoor-rated conduit, correct burial depths where applicable, and conductor sizing based on ampacity and distance. A properly placed service disconnect (typically 5–50 feet and in line of sight) allows safe maintenance and testing. A licensed electrician will also perform a load calculation to confirm your service can handle the spa without dimming lights or nuisance trips.
